5 Causes of Tile Popping in Your Floors

Image_Thumbnail_RK_Mortar_4

Have you ever heard the term “popping”? In construction, popping refers to when installed floor tiles bulge upward and burst. Yes — burst. But before that happens, the tile will first bulge and lift. Once a tile starts lifting, you’ll definitely notice. To prevent popping, we first need to understand what causes it. Let’s break down 5 causes of tile popping.

 

1. Voids Beneath the Tile

During installation, make sure the tile bonds evenly and fully to the tile adhesive. If a void exists, the trapped air underneath can expand and push the tile up or sideways. Unevenly installed tile can also be a safety hazard and makes the tile more prone to cracking.

 

2. Water Seepage

Water seepage can happen for two reasons: worn or deteriorated grout over time, or poor workmanship. Rushed work, or work done by an inexperienced tradesperson, can have long-lasting effects. Pay close attention during installation to avoid this issue.

 

3. Ground Structure

Ground movement can also affect your tile. If your home sits on shifting soil, there’s a chance your house — and its tile — could be affected. Make sure to check whether your area is prone to shifting ground or earthquakes to help prevent popping.

 

4. Excessive Load

Prolonged excessive load can also cause popping, especially common with larger-format tiles. Larger tiles have a bigger surface area, which increases the risk of cracking under uneven, prolonged load. Pay attention to your furniture placement to help avoid this.

 

5. Rising Temperature

This typically happens during hot weather. Rising temperatures cause tiles to expand. If there’s a void beneath the tile, the trapped air will also expand, increasing the risk of cracking. Lower-quality tile also increases the risk of popping.
